The pancreas is a vital, oblong gland located behind the stomach in the upper abdomen that aids in digestion and blood sugar regulation. It functions as both an exocrine gland (releasing enzymes to digest food) and an endocrine gland (releasing hormones like insulin and glucagon) to maintain metabolic balance.
Chronic pancreatitis is a long-term, progressive inflammatory disease of the pancreas that does not heal or improve, resulting in irreversible structural damage and permanent loss of function. Chronic pancreatitis involves ongoing damage, typically leading to scarring (fibrosis), calcification, and ductal distortion.
